When to Use

User needs to capture any type of notes: meetings, brainstorms, decisions, daily journals, or project logs. Agent handles formatting, platform routing (local or external apps), action item extraction, and retrieval across all configured platforms.

Scope

This skill ONLY:

  • Creates and manages markdown files in ~/notes/
  • Runs user-installed CLI tools (memo, grizzly, obsidian-cli, clinote) if present and configured
  • Calls Notion API only when user has configured Notion integration
  • Reads config from ~/notes/config.md to route notes to platforms

This skill NEVER:

  • Installs software automatically
  • Accesses credential files without explicit user permission
  • Reads files outside ~/notes/ (except platform CLIs)
  • Sends data to external services unless user configures that platform
  • Modifies system settings or other applications

Core Rules

1. Route to Configured Platform

Check ~/notes/config.md for platform routing:

# Platform Routing
meetings: local          # or: apple-notes, bear, obsidian, notion
decisions: local
projects: notion
journal: bear
quick: apple-notes

If note type not configured, use local. If platform not available (missing CLI/credentials), fall back to local with warning.

2. Always Use Structured Format

Every note type has a specific format regardless of platform. See formats.md for templates.

Note TypeTriggerKey Elements
Meeting"meeting notes", "call with"Attendees, decisions, actions
Decision"we decided", "decision:"Context, options, rationale
Brainstorm"ideas for", "brainstorm"Raw ideas, clusters, next steps
Journal"daily note", "today I"Date, highlights, blockers
Project"project update", "status"Progress, blockers, next
Quick"note:", "remember"Minimal format, tags

3. Extract Action Items Aggressively

If someone says "I'll do X" or "we need to Y", that is an action item.

Every action item MUST have:

  • Owner: Who is responsible (@name)
  • Task: Specific, actionable description
  • Deadline: Explicit date (not "soon" or "ASAP")

Action items sync to ~/notes/actions.md regardless of which platform holds the note.

5. Unified Search Across Platforms

When searching notes:

  1. Search local ~/notes/ first
  2. Search each configured external platform
  3. Combine results with source indicators

Example output:

Search: "product roadmap"

Local:
  [[2026-02-19_product-sync]] - meeting, ~/notes/meetings/

Notion:
  "Q1 Roadmap" - page, Projects database

Bear:
  "Roadmap Ideas" - #product #planning

6. Cross-Platform Action Tracking

~/notes/actions.md is the SINGLE source of truth for all action items, regardless of where the note lives.

Format includes source:

| Task | Owner | Due | Source |
|------|-------|-----|--------|
| Review proposal | @alice | 2026-02-20 | local:[[2026-02-19_sync]] |
| Update roadmap | @bob | 2026-02-22 | notion:Q1 Planning |
| Draft post | @me | 2026-02-21 | bear:#content-ideas |

7. Filename Convention (Local)

For local notes: YYYY-MM-DD_topic-slug.md (date first, then topic)

External platforms use their native naming/organization.

Common Traps

  • Platform misconfiguration: Always verify platform is available before attempting. Fall back gracefully.
  • Vague deadlines: "ASAP", "soon", "next week" are not deadlines. Force explicit dates.
  • Missing owners: "We should do X" needs "@who will do X"
  • Split action tracking: Never track actions only in the external platform. Always sync to central tracker.
  • No retrieval tags: A note without tags is a note you will never find.

Security & Privacy

Data flow by platform:

  • Local: All data stays in ~/notes/. No network.
  • Apple Notes: Data stays local. memo CLI communicates with Notes.app via macOS APIs.
  • Bear: Data stays local. grizzly CLI communicates with Bear.app.
  • Obsidian: Data stays local. obsidian-cli reads/writes vault files.
  • Notion: Note content sent to api.notion.com. Requires user-provided API key.
  • Evernote: Note content sent to Evernote servers via clinote. Requires user login.

Credential handling:

  • Agent asks permission before checking for credentials
  • Agent never reads ~/.config/notion/api_key or ~/.config/grizzly/token without explicit user consent
  • User sets up credentials themselves via platform documentation

What stays local always:

  • Action items tracker: ~/notes/actions.md
  • Note index: ~/notes/index.md
  • Platform config: ~/notes/config.md
